Amherst Insurance Agency Discusses Flood Insurance

Many agencies located on the east coast have been receiving a lot of questions around the topic of flood insurance. Encharter Insurance, an agency located in Amherst, Massachusetts shares some insight to some of the more common questions. They discuss how many think water damage caused by flooding is covered by the homeowners policy. This is not true.
